Факторио - это вам не змейка
kvisaz — 15.09.2024https://www.reddit.com/r/OpenAI/comments/1fg1v4u/o1preview_exceeded_my_expectations/
Пишут что новая нейронка o1 практически без багов сделала рабочее демо игры Факторио для браузера
стек - Питон + JS
Если это правда, то это бомба, потому что даже такой простой вариант Факторио - это на голову выше Змейки. Блин, змейку на jS можно написать в 128 знаков, это простая игра (пример читабельного кода - https://github.com/guckstift/shortest-js-snake/blob/master/index.html). Поэтому если кто-то кричит - "о, нейронка мне змейку написала" - просто посылайте его за более сложным примером, потому что код змейки довольно прост. Это как хелло-ворлд для игроделов.
Правда там человек не просто задал запрос - "сделай игру", а шел по цепочке промптов
- Можете ли вы написать мне прототип игры-строителя фабрик, вдохновленной такими играми, как Factorio, Satisfactory, Dyson Sphere Program и т. д., с использованием Pygame?
- Проведите мозговой штурм по функциям, которые создадут удовлетворяющий опыт строительства фабрики
- теперь следует выбрать те функции, которые он сочтет наиболее важными, и заняться их реализацией.
- Теперь давайте полностью переделаем камеру и маленький мир в открытый мир. Я хочу, чтобы камера всегда была сосредоточена на игроке. Части новой области будут загружаться, если игрок движется в их направлении, и выгружаться, как только он выходит за пределы экрана. Любые производственные мощности должны будут продолжать работать, даже если игрок в данный момент не просматривает свою область экрана. Дайте всем узлам на сетке, таким как железные и медные узлы, шахтеры, сборщики и конвейеры, столкновение, чтобы игрок не мог пройти сквозь них»
По моему опыту, с такой цепочкой промптов и в обычных Гпт4 и Клоде 3.5 можно добиться сразу многого, так как нейронка словно погружается в контекст, а не берет первый рандомный ответ со стековерфлоу.
Но автор пишет, что на ГПТ4 он бы застрял на бесконечных багах, а o1 сделал сразу. Это его мнение.
А я от платной подписки давно отказался и теперь сижу, думаю, возвращать или нет.
|
</> |